When the New York Giants played the Chicago Bears a couple of weeks ago we asked you whether you would prefer quarterback Mitchell Trubisky or All-Pro linebacker Khalil Mack if you could have one of them for the Giants.

Overwhelming (77 percent to 23 percent) voters in in our poll chose Mack, the extraordinary pass rusher.

The Giants face the Indianapolis Colts this week. Let’s go through that exercise again. which of the following three Colts’ players would you choose if you could bring one to the Giants?

Quarterback Andrew Luck — The Giants need a long-term answer at quarterback. Luck is playing as well as ever after missing a year with a shoulder issue. He is still just 29 and has several years of elite play left.

Guard Quenton Nelson — The Giants could have had Nelson in the 2018 NFL Draft. He would make a tremendous guard tandem with Will Hernandez, though one would have to move to the right side.

Linebacker Darius Leonard — The rookie linebacker has a strong case for Defensive Rookie of the Year. He leads the league in tackles. He can play the run, rush the passer and hold up in coverage against wide receivers. Wouldn’t that be something? A do-it-all linebacker on the Giants.
